Recently opened, The Lane Retreat offers a diverse range of indoor and outdoor venues for your next event, incentive, meeting or corporate getaway, all set within the grounds of Bimbadgen’s 50-year-old vineyards with panoramic views over the Broken Back Range or nearby Bimbadgen estate.

Developed by property and hospitality group Mulpha Australia, The Lane Retreat has been designed to provide a unique accommodation offering to complement the brand’s Palmer Lane wedding and events venue and the winery and restaurants at Bimbadgen’s home vineyard on McDonald Road.

Onsite activities include winery tours, wine and gin tasting, yoga and meditation and team building challenges.  Offsite activities include golf, spa day packages and scenic tours by helicopter or hot air balloon.

Located conveniently next door to The Lane Retreat, The Palmer’s Lane venue room promises a beautiful setting for any event overlooking the vineyards and natural bushland. It includes an indoor area which can be used as a flexible blank canvas, adaptable to your preferred layout, ensuring a tailored environment for exercises and workshops.  It can accommodate up to 130 pax for lunch and dinner and up to 170 pax for cocktails.  Delegates can also enjoy the charming outdoor gazebo for lunches and breakout sessions.

With seating for up to 90 pax, Bimbadgen’s Pizzeria, with its Tuscan style courtyard and vine-covered pergola is great for a casual wood-fired pizza lunch or dinner with a glass of wine or two, with views over the vineyards.

Delegates also have access to the Mulpha-owned Bimbadgen Wines and its sister property Emma’s Cottage Vineyard boutique winery nearby.   Bimbadgen wines is home to Esca Bimbadgen restaurant where simple, elegant food is carefully curated and expertly paired with the estate’s wines as well as other outstanding Hunter region wines.

The restaurant, with its panoramic view over the vineyards can seat up to 100 pax with the Terrace area seating up to 40 pax.  Also available for private bookings is the Cellar Door Private Dining room with a capacity of up to 20 pax.

Just a 5-minute drive away is Emma’s Cottage Vineyard, a boutique winery with a cellar door and ‘Wine Shed’ is perfect for private events seating up to 80 pax.

The recently opened The Lane Retreat offers 60 premium studio retreats with outdoor decks offering panoramic views of the Broken Back Range or Bimbadgen vineyards. Cocooned in comfort, guests will enjoy a rare combination of privacy, elevated touches, and connection to wine country.
